
The Curse of Carne's Hold: A Tale of Adventure, written by G. A. Henty and first published in 1889, is a historical novel set against the backdrop of South Africa's Frontier Wars (1811-1878). The story follows the Carne family, who are haunted by a curse linked to their ancestral home, Carne's Hold, and explores themes of family legacy and the impact of past actions. The narrative features characters like Reginald and Margaret Carne, as well as Lieutenant Gulston, as they navigate the tensions and mysteries surrounding their family's dark history.
